[QUOTE="Analoguesat, post: 88703, member: 176362"] A clean install just means you start with a clean registry - you dont have all the extra crap from programmes you tried out 2 years ago which didnt uninstall properly... The slave drive would be seen as an extra drive letter, from which you just copy the data files from the slave to a new directory on the new drive. You would need to do new installations of whichever programmes you wanted to use again - your MS Works ( which version did you have?) for instance. Then you can manipulate your data again using the original programme. [/QUOTE]
